MSNBC “Hardball” host Chris Matthews told his staff tonight that he will not be running for the U.S. Senate in 2010 from Pennsylvania, ending months of mind-numbing speculation. That move bumps up the profiles of the lesser known but more qualified possible Democratic contenders: State Rep. Josh Shapiro and U.S. Rep. Patrick Murphy -- both of whom hail from eastern Pennsylvania. Whoever wins that spot would possibly face incumbent Republican Sen.
